    Wayman was 6'9" tall and fell on stairs and it was discovered that he had cancer of the knee. Due to his large frame, doctors weren't sure how much chemo to give him and eventually they did amputate his leg in an effort to stop the cancer but ultimately it took his life at age 44. He was multitalented though playing 12 seasons in the NBA and also had a career as a jazz guitarist and pastor. Both Toby and Wayman lived in Oklahoma.
